Diagrama Relacional

CRISTIAN ALEJANDRO RAMIREZ MARTINEZ


             ¿Qué es el diagrama relacional?


Un diagrama relacional, también conocido como diagrama entidad-relación, es una herramienta visual que nos permite entender y organizar cómo diferentes elementos dentro de un sistema están relacionados entre sí. Este tipo de diagrama se utiliza principalmente en el diseño de bases de datos, que es como el cerebro de una aplicación o sistema, donde se almacena toda la información.

Ejemplo: 
Imagina que estamos construyendo una gran lista o archivo sobre algo importante, como una biblioteca. Queremos saber qué libros tenemos, quiénes los pueden pedir prestados y cómo se conectan esas dos cosas. El diagrama relacional es como un mapa que nos muestra qué elementos existen (como los libros y las personas) y cómo se relacionan entre sí (por ejemplo, qué persona tiene qué libro).


Emili Elizabeth Ríos Rocha

Componentes principales:

1. Entidades:
Son los objetos o conceptos principales de los que estamos hablando. En el caso de la biblioteca, las entidades podrían ser "Libros" y "Usuarios". Una entidad es algo que podemos identificar claramente y sobre lo que necesitamos guardar información. Ejemplo: "Libros" sería una entidad que contiene todos los libros de la biblioteca. "Usuarios" sería otra entidad que incluye a todas las personas que pueden pedir prestados esos libros.

 2.Atributos:
Son los detalles o características de las entidades. Cada entidad tiene atributos que describen sus propiedades. Para los libros, los atributos podrían ser el "Título" , "Autor" , y "Año de Publicación". Para los usuarios, podrían ser "Nombre" , "Dirección" , y "Número de Teléfono". Ejemplo: El atributo "Título" nos dice el nombre del libro, mientras que "Nombre" nos dice cómo se llama un usuario.

 3. Relaciones: 
Nos muestran cómo las entidades están conectadas entre sí. En la biblioteca, una relación sería "Un usuario puede pedir prestado un libro". Esto significa que la entidad "Usuarios" está conectada con la entidad "Libros" a través de esta relación. Ejemplo: Si un usuario llamado Juan pidió prestado un libro llamado "El Principito" , la relación entre la entidad "Usuarios" y la entidad "Libros" se establece a través de esta acción. 

4. Cardinalidad: 
Indica cuántas veces una entidad puede estar conectada con otra. Por ejemplo, un usuario puede pedir prestado varios libros (1:N), o un libro puede ser prestado a varios usuarios en momentos diferentes (N:M). Ejemplo: Si un libro puede ser prestado a muchos usuarios, la cardinalidad sería N:M.


Neri Alexis Ramirez Herrera

RESUMEN:

Un diagrama relacional nos ayuda a ver, de manera clara y ordenada, quiénes son los personajes principales de un sistema (las entidades).




 qué detalles importantes tenemos sobre ellos (los atributos), cómo están conectados (las relaciones), y cuántas conexiones puede haber (la cardinalidad). 







Es como un plano que nos permite entender cómo fluye la información dentro de una base de datos.







BIBLIOGRAFIA


Conceptos que se encuentran en libros de diseño de bases de datos y modelado de datos, como el "Database Systems: The Complete Book" de Hector Garcia-Molina, Jeffrey Ullman y Jennifer Widom.


DISEÑO HECHO POR EL EQUIPO 10 DE LA MATERIA DE BASE DE DATOS




Comentarios